Hey Jayda, just wanted to let you know, I was having issues advancing past row 7, when I started at the peak, because my stitches were shifting between the peak and valley, causing an extra stitch or a lost stitch. Reviewing your video, I did find a solution. I am using row 5 to advance through the rows and it is easier for me and the stitch count for each row is remaining correct. The waltz effect of the pattern, for me, is easier to follow. I am finally advancing through the pattern on row 16 without issues. Wanted to share this tip, in case anyone was experiencing the same issue. Thank you for the pattern, my blanket is turning out great.
